- Homicide Defense

Even in cases where evidence exists connecting the accused to a murder, convicting someone for homicide is not a straightforward, simple matter. Typically, the seriousness of the charge will depend on whether the prosecutor believes the accused intended to kill the victim, whether the crime was planned, and whether enough physical evidence exists to link the accused to the actual crime itself. As such, the prosecution must establish the accused's mental state, motive, and physical action to accomplish the crime. Failure to establish any one of these factors will result in acquittal or a reduction in charges.

- DUI / DUI Manslaughter Charges

Florida has heavy penalties for drunk driving. Consequences can involve license revocation, fines, and jail time. When a person has been injured or killed, penalties become include multiple years in state prison. Florida sentencing guidelines allow for twelve (12) to thirty (30) years in prison for a DUI/DWI vehicular manslaughter conviction. - Jimmy Ryce Defense

Because of changes in the law under the Jimmy Ryce Act (Jimmy Ryce Involuntary Civil Commitment for Sexually Violent Predators' Treatment and Care Act), sexual offenders may be forced into a mental treatment facility after serving their prison sentence. - Sex Offender Registration

Under Florida state law, persons convicted for felony sex crimes are required to register as sex offenders with the local authorities. Those convicted for misdemeanor sexual offenses may or may not be required to register, depending on the decision of the court. Failure to register promptly and comply with sex offender requirements could result in arrest and incarceration. - Post-Conviction and Collateral Relief

After you have exhausted all direct appeals from your criminal conviction, legal actions are often still available through the courts to help you seek the freedom you deserve. Attorneys at Muller & Sommerville, P.A., have achieved a great deal of success in motioning the court for collateral and post-conviction relief, including federal and state writs of habeas corpus and Rule 3.850 motions. When these motions are made, the court hears arguments concerning issues like inadequate representation by an attorney, violations of due process, or other legal reasons to set aside your guilty plea or conviction.

- Attorneys and Grievance Hearings

People who have passed the bar may be denied a license to practice law if the Florida Bar believes a candidate's past behavior raises questions about his or her fitness to practice law. Our attorneys have extensive experience in counseling and representing clients who face an investigative hearing before the Florida Bar on allegations of misconduct. These allegations can range from practicing law without a license, to providing legal advice without a license, to conducting questionable legal services or engaging in business practices as an attorney prior to being properly licensed.
